Dead coin battery

A dead battery is among the most frequent reasons for a key fob that isn't working. Replacing it is easy and takes only few minutes, however the first thing you need to ensure that you're using the correct type of battery. The majority of key fobs utilize CR2032 3V batteries, which are available at most electronics stores and online. Your owner's manual, or a YouTube video should provide instructions to open the key fob and replacing the battery.

Water damage

It is crucial to act quickly if your key fob is submerged in water. Water and electronics aren't an ideal mix and could cause damage to the circuit board. A key fob that is wet will also stop working. This is why it is important to fix the problem as quickly as you can.

If you've accidentally dropped your key fob in the water or puddle or even put it in the washing machine by accident the first thing to do is to remove the battery and allow it to dry out completely. You can also use paper towel or tissue to dry the outer casing. You can also try putting it in a bag that contains silica gel packets that helps to absorb water.

Once your key fob is fully dried, it's time to put it back together. Make sure that the battery is properly inserted and the metal contacts on the circuit board are clean. If necessary, you can use a little isopropyl clean the contacts.

You should be able to begin your vehicle using the key fob after all this. If it still isn't able to start, there may be other issues that need to dealt with. This could be a damaged key, or a transponder that must be reprogrammed.
